
【電】 dynamic allocation
dynamic; dynamic state; trends
【經】 movement
allocation; collocate; configure; deploy; dispose; marshal; station
【計】 configuration; factoring
動态配置(Dynamic Configuration)在漢英詞典中對應“dynamic configuration”,指系統或應用程式在運行過程中實時調整參數、資源分配或功能模塊的能力。這一概念強調無需停機或重新部署即可實現適應性變化,常見于現代軟件架構和雲計算領域。
從技術實現角度,動态配置通常通過中心化配置服務器(如Spring Cloud Config)或環境變量注入完成。微軟Azure文檔指出,動态資源配置使雲計算平台能夠根據負載自動擴展計算實例,例如将虛拟機數量從2台實時調整為10台以應對流量高峰。
在軟件開發領域,動态配置具有三大核心優勢:
IEEE 15288标準将動态配置能力列為複雜系統可靠性的關鍵評估指标,強調其通過冗餘資源切換和QoS參數調整保障服務連續性。在實際應用中,這種技術已延伸至物聯網設備管理領域,例如華為IoT平台支持對百萬級終端設備進行批量配置更新。
動态配置是指在應用運行過程中,無需重啟服務即可實時修改和更新配置信息的技術機制。以下是其核心要點:
動态配置常見于分布式系統和微服務架構中,通過集中化管理配置參數(如數據庫連接、日志級别等),實現運行時調整。例如,修改數據庫密碼後,所有相關服務自動同步新配置,無需逐一重啟。
C('參數名', '新值')
)或配置中心(如Nacos)實現,不影響服務運行。在金融領域,“動态資産配置”指根據市場變化調整投資組合,屬于完全不同的概念,需注意區分。
如需進一步了解技術實現,可參考阿裡雲DRM或Nacos動态配置文檔。
【别人正在浏覽】